× I usually go to the library to complete my assignments or to focus on my exams because it is very quiet place.
✓ I usually go to the library to complete my assignments or to focus on my exams because it is a very quiet place.
The phrase 'very quiet place' is missing the indefinite article 'a' before 'very quiet place'. In English, singular countable nouns require an article or determiner. Therefore, 'a very quiet place' is correct.
× This calm environment helped me to concentrate without any distraction which make it an ideal sport for studying.
✓ This calm environment helped me to concentrate without any distraction which makes it an ideal spot for studying.
The word 'sport' is incorrect in this context; the correct word is 'spot' meaning a place. Also, 'make' should be 'makes' to agree with the singular subject 'which' referring to 'environment'. This correction addresses both word choice and subject-verb agreement.
× No, I don't go to the library when I was scared.
✓ No, I didn't go to the library when I was scared.
The sentence mixes present tense 'don't go' with past time 'when I was scared'. The correct past tense form is 'didn't go' to match the past time reference.
